The comedy is considered one of the best television series of all time and is the winner of numerous awards including thirty-one Primetime Emmy awards. The series centers around a middle-class family and their interactions with their friends, neighbors, and the rest of the citizens of the fictional town of Springfield. The annual Treehouse of Horrors Halloween specials are some of the series’ best installments. Notice how much the animation evolves from the early seasons to the current episodes. Pay close attention to the writing on the chalkboard in each episode’s opening credits and be impressed by the creative couch gags. You’ll be surprised by the hundreds of celebrity guests who have lent their voices to the show over the years including Kelsey Grammer, Phil Hartman, Michael Jackson, Paul McCartney, Dustin Hoffman, Glenn Close, Meryl Streep, and countless others.
